VME | |
---|---|
Utvecklaren | International Computers Limited |
Första upplagan | januari 1970 |
Hemsida | www.fujitsu.com/uk/services/… |
VME ( Virtual Machine Environment ) är ett stordatoroperativsystem utvecklat i Storbritannien av International Computers Ltd på 1970 -talet [1] [2] .
Produktionen av systemet började med sammanslagningen av International Computers and Tabulators (ICT) och English Electric Computers 1968. De 3 mest kända sammansättningarna är:
VME har utvecklats för maskinerna i 2900- och 39-serien sedan början av 1970-talet. Under utvecklingen användes en top-down design, systemet skapades på ett språk på hög nivå, en dialekt av ALGOL 68. Totalt består operativsystemet av 8 tusen moduler, mer än 200 personer deltog i skapandet [ 3] .
Huvudarkitekten för VME/B var Brian Warboys [4] som senare blev professor i mjukvaruteknik vid University of Manchester.
VME sågs främst som en konkurrent med System/360 IBM stordator som ett kommersiellt EBCDIC-kodat operativsystem.
VME skrevs ursprungligen nästan helt i S3, ett anpassat språk baserat på Algol 68R. Även om ett språk på hög nivå används är operativsystemet inte utformat för att vara oberoende av den underliggande hårdvaruarkitekturen: tvärtom är mjukvaru- och hårdvaruarkitekturen tätt kopplade.
Från början av 1990-talet och framåt skrevs några helt nya VME-delsystem helt eller delvis i programmeringsspråket C.
Från dess tidigaste dagar har VME utvecklats med hjälp av ett programmeringsförråd känt som CADES, byggt för att använda kärnan i IDMS-databasen.
Från och med 1997 var över tusen ICL stordatorer i bruk i Storbritannien [5] .